THE FUTURE OF DESIGN IN HONOLULU, film and panel discussion. Architecture Month event at Honolulu Design Center, Kapi'olani Boulevard: mingle with Island architects during 5:30 p.m. no-host cocktails; 6 p.m. panel discussion by Bill Brooks, Geoff Lewis and A. Kam Napier, moderated by Francis Oda; one-hour showing of the documentary "True to Form: Vladimir Ossipoff," about internationally known Island architect who supported localized, appropriate design; free.

DEPARTMENT OF LAND AND NATURAL RESOURCES PUBLIC HEARING 6 p.m. at the Kalanimoku State Office Building, Conference Room 132, on the proposed Poamoho Natural Area Reserve, which would safeguard rare and endangered plants and animals; draft and map may be viewed in Room 325.
